A lot of people wonder if they’re supposed to tip their car detailer after a service. The honest answer is tips are never required.

Unlike some service industries that rely on tips to make up income, professional detailing prices are typically set to fairly compensate the detailer for their time, labor, skill, products, and overhead. That means detailers generally price their services so they can earn a living without expecting tips.


Why Detailing Costs What It Does

A proper detail is more than a quick wash. It often involves:

  • Deep interior cleaning

  • Stain and odor removal

  • Paint care and protection

  • Restoring neglected areas

  • Hours of physical labor and attention to detail

Pricing usually reflects the amount of work involved, along with equipment, chemicals, travel costs, and business expenses.


So, Should You Tip?

Tipping Detailers is not necessary. Their pricing should already account for the service being provided.

That said, tips are always greatly appreciated and seen as a kind gesture when a customer is especially happy with the results.

Many people choose to tip when:

  • The vehicle was extremely dirty

  • Extra effort was put into difficult areas

  • The results exceeded expectations

  • The detailer was professional and easy to work with

  • They simply want to show appreciation


Other Great Ways to Support a Detailer

Even without tipping, you can help a detailing business by:

  • Leaving a 5-star review

  • Referring friends and family

  • Rebooking future services

  • Sharing their business online

These often help just as much as a tip.


Final Thoughts

Car detailers don’t need tips in the way some industries do, because their pricing is designed to compensate them for the work. But when a customer chooses to tip, it’s always appreciated and never forgotten.
